医院血库管理系统需求分析.docx
《医院血库管理系统需求分析.docx》由会员分享,可在线阅读,更多相关《医院血库管理系统需求分析.docx(10页珍藏版)》请在冰点文库上搜索。
医院血库管理系统需求分析
医院血库管理系统
需求分析
学生姓名:
张晓枫
学院:
信息工程学院
专业:
信息管理与信息系统
班级:
B1602班
学号:
0916160217
指导教师:
金鸣镝
辽东学院
EasternLiaoningUniversity
一、可行性分析报告
系统开发的有关背景:
医院血库管理系统是一个医院不可缺少的部分。
人工管理方式存在着许多缺点:
效率低,保密性差,另外时间一长,将产生大量的文件和数据,这对于查找,更新和维护都带来不少困难。
随着科学技术的不断提高,计算机学日渐成熟。
它已进入人类社会的各个领域并发挥重要作用。
使用计算机档案信息管理,有好多好处:
查找方便,可靠性高,存储量大,保密性好,成本低等,能够极大提高管理的效率,也是医院信息管理的科学化,与世界接轨的重要条件。
系统开发项目的目标:
目标:
提高工作效率,建立数据一致性和完整性强,数据安全性好的数据库,开发功能完备、易使用的前端应用程序。
可能性分析:
当前,计算机价格已经十分低廉,性能却有了长足的进步。
它已经应用于许多领域。
现在我国的病人及医师管理水平绝大部分停留在纸介质的基础上,这样的机制已经不能适应时代的发展,因为它浪费了许多人力和物力,在信息时代,这种传统的管理方法必然被以计算机为基础的信息管理所取代。
因此,血库管理信息系统的建立具备很大的可能性。
必要性分析:
血库管理系统是每个医疗机构管理病人和医生必不可少的管理信息系统,它的内容对于医疗机构的管理者来说是至关重要的,所以血库管理系统应该能够为每一个医疗机构的管理者提供充足的信息和快捷的查询手段,大大的方便医疗机构的管理者的合理管理。
计算机的成熟应用已经进入各个行业领域,血库管理的工作必然要借助计算机技术。
使用计算机对血库进行管理,具有手工管理无可比拟的优点:
检索迅速、查找方便、可靠性高、存储量大、保密性好、寿命成本低等。
能够极大地提高管理效率。
这些优点能够极大地提高病人及医师管理的效率,也是医疗机构理财的科学化、正规化管理与先进科学技术接轨的重要条件。
因此,开发这样一套管理系统是很有必要的,从某种意义上讲也是将计算机应用于现实管理的一次很有意义的实践活动。
系统主要功能结构:
第一,系统维护包括用户管理、密码管理、数据库备份、背景设置、退出等选项。
第二,血液管理包括入库信息与出库信息。
第三,系统查询包括血液库存及出入库查询和打印。
第四,系统帮助包括系统关于及辅助文件。
系统开发可行性分析:
一、技术可行性:
本系统将采用MicrosoftSQLServer2005技术。
SQL是英文StructuredQueryLanguage的缩写,意思为结构化查询语言。
SQL语言的主要功能就是同各种数据库建立联系,进行沟通。
按照ANSI(美国国家标准协会)的规定,SQL被作为关系型数据库管理系统的标准语言。
SQL语句可以用来执行各种各样的操作,例如更新数据库中的数据,从数据库中提取数据等。
目前,绝大多数流行的关系型数据库管理系统,如Oracle,Sybase,MicrosoftSQLServer,Access等都采用了SQL语言标准。
MicrosoftSQLServer2005是一个全面的数据库平台,使用集成的商业智能(BI)工具提供了企业级的数据管理。
MicrosoftSQLServer2005数据库引擎为关系型数据和结构化数据提供了更安全可靠的存储功能,使您可以构建和管理用于业务的高可用和高性能的数据应用程序。
MicrosoftSQLServer2005数据引擎是该企业数据管理解决方案的核心。
此外MicrosoftSQLServer2005结合了分析、报表、集成和通知功能。
这使企业可以构建和部署经济有效的BI解决方案,帮助您的团队通过记分卡、Dashboard、Webservices和移动设备将数据应用推向业务的各个领域。
与MicrosoftVisualStudio、MicrosoftOfficeSystem以及新的开发工具包(包括BusinessIntelligenceDevelopmentStudio)的紧密集成使MicrosoftSQLServer2005与众不同。
无论您是开发人员、数据库管理员、信息工作者还是决策者,MicrosoftSQLServer2005都可以为您提供创新的解决方案,帮助您从数据中更多地获益。
二、经济可行性:
一个系统从开发到投入使用要考虑到很多的费用开销,主要包括设备的购买费用,软件的开发费用,系统的维护费用等等,而本系统的开发周期不是很长,运行时对硬件的配置要求也不是很高,管理员经过简单的培训就可以胜任,维护起来也方便。
三、管理可行性:
本系统操作简单,管理员经过一段时间的培训以后,就可以独立完成对本系统的管理。
通过三个方面的分析,可以明确该系统的设计是可行的,具有经济,技术,管理等方面的支持,满足了系统开发的基础和前提条件的要求,为系统开发的进一步实施明确了目标。
二、业务流程图
三、数据流程图
血库血液管理信息系统顶层数据流程图
血库血液管理信息系统中层数据流程图
输血申请处理(P1)数据流程底图
血液出库(P2)数据流程底图
献血申请处理(P3)数据流程底图
血液入库(P4)数据流程底图
过期血液排查(P5)数据流程底图
四、数据字典
(1)数据结构的定义
数据结构编号:
DT01
数据结构名称:
输血申请单
简述:
患者所需血量、血型等信息
数据结构组成:
姓名+性别+申请原因
数据结构编号:
DT02
数据结构名称:
明细单
简述:
每一条进出库详细信息
数据结构组成:
DS002+入库信息+出库信息
(2)数据流定义
数据流编号:
DT03
数据流名称:
血液出库单
简述:
血库批准通过的申请单
数据流来源:
血库管理者
数据流组成:
领用血量+血型+日期+领用科室
(数据流量:
10袋/天高峰流量:
25袋/天)
数据流编号:
DT04
数据流名称:
血液入库单
简述:
采集血量的详细信息
数据流来源:
采血人员
数据流去向:
血液入库模块
数据流组成:
献血量+日期+血型+献血人员的详细信息
(数据流量:
8袋/天高峰流量:
18袋/天)
(3)处理逻辑的定义
处理逻辑编号:
P1
处理逻辑名称:
输血申请处理
简述:
根据患者病情
输入的数据流:
患者病情、库存单、用血量、血型、日期
输出的数据流:
合格输血申请单
处理:
再根据库存单、用血量判定血量是否足够等信息最后得到合格清单。
处理逻辑编号:
P2
处理逻辑名称:
血液出库处理
简述:
对用血的相关信息进行的记录
输入的数据流:
患者姓名、血型、日期、用血量。
输出的数据流:
出库单
处理:
根据患者姓名核对用血信息;根据日期判定其过期与否;根据血型、用血量得到最终的出库单。
处理逻辑编号:
P4
处理逻辑名称:
血液入库处理
简述:
对采血相关信息进行录入,形成库存记录
输入的数据流:
献血人员姓名性别、采血量、日期
输出的数据流:
血液入库单
处理:
对献血人员姓名性别、采血量、日期进行录入、整合,得到规范的库存记录。
处理逻辑编号:
P3
处理逻辑名称:
献血申请处理
简述:
按照献血标准
输入的数据流:
献血人员姓名性别、采血量、日期、采血人员姓名,性别,工作编号
输出的数据流:
合格献血申请单
处理:
根据献血人员姓名性别、采血量、日期得到合格的入库报表。
(4)
(5)数据存储的定义
数据存储编号:
D2
数据存储名称:
库存记录
简述:
血库中各种血型的存量
数据存储组成:
血型+数量+日期
关键字:
血型
相关联的处理:
P2,P3,P4
数据存储编号:
D1、D3
数据存储名称:
血库工作记录
简述:
血液出入库的详细记录
数据存储组成:
用血数据+采血数据
关键字:
用血量,采血量
相关联的处理:
P1,P2,P3,P4
(5)外部实体的定义
外部实体编号:
E1
外部实体名称:
用血病人
输入的数据流:
患者详细信息
输出的数据流:
用血申请单
外部实体编号:
E2
外部实体名称:
献血者
输入的数据流:
献血人员的详细信息
输出的数据流:
献血单
外部实体编号:
E3
外部实体名称:
血库管理部门
简述:
血库管理部门工作人员
输入的数据流:
明细单
输出的数据流:
管理决策文档